    CCMB Pub Quiz 13

    For those of you who are interested here are some quiz questions for you to have a go at……..




    1. Which British Snack Food Brand manufactures Jaffa Cakes ?



    2. According to the Nursery Rhyme which child is full of woe ?



    3. In terms of area what is the largest county of the Republic of Ireland ?



    4. Which Media Mogul is referred to in the magazine “Private Eye” as “Dirty Digger” ?



    5. In cookery what is the name given to a dish of kidneys that have been cooked in a spiced sauce ?



    6. If you receive a text and it says FYEO what does it stand for ?



    7. Who is the main presenter of the TV programme “The Great British Bake Off : An Extra Slice” ?



    8. Football - who is the last Englishman to score in a Champions League Final ?



    9. Which album cover features David Bowie with a lightning bolt painted across his face ?



    10. Scrivener’s Palsy is an archaic name for which condition of the hand or forearm ?



    11. The Uffizi is an Art Gallery and Museum in which European City ?



    12. Which Shakespeare Play has a title that contains a gerund ?



    13. In 1984 the name Nissan replaced which brand name for its cars in the UK ?



    14. His first UK No 1 single was “I’m Not Alone” in 2009 and his 8th and most recent was “Promises” in 2018 - who is he ?



    15.This character from history has been played on film by Charlton Heston (1970), Richard Burton (1963) and Sid James (1964) - which character is it ?



    16. Boxing - which future World Boxing Champion had his first professional fight on the undercard of the 1993 Lennox Lewis v Frank Bruno WBC Title fight at the National Stadium Cardiff ?




    17. Which American Animation Studio founded by Stephen Spielberg has a logo consisting of a boy fishing and sitting on a crescent moon ?


    18. The Primary Hub for German Airline Lufthansa is in which city ?



    19. What is the name of the photographer who works on the Daily Planet with Clark Kent and Lois Lane ?



    20. For which James Bond Film, starring Sean Connery, did Roald Dahl write the screenplay ?



    21. Which famous Musical is set in the dreams of a young child called “Control” ?



    22. Notting Hill, home of the Carnival, Portobello Road Market and many sought after properties is in which London Borough ?



    23. If the Arab world call one of the arms of the Red Sea the Gulf of Aqaba what do they call it in Israel ?



    24. Cricket - born in Australia he played in 11 tests for England from 2008 as a wicketkeeper and scored a Test century - who is he ?



    25. Name the year - the Government proposes a Car Tax of £1 per horsepower, the first Women Jury members are appointed and the German Workers Party becomes the Nazi Party.



    26. In the film Reservoir Dogs which actor famously dances to the song “Stuck in the Middle With You” whilst cutting a Policeman’s ear off ?



    27. The Jacobite Rebellion took place when the majority of the English Army was in mainland Europe fighting which major war ?



    28. Which Cheshire town is the location of the design and manufacturing centre of Bentley Motor Cars ?



    29. Which famous Spanish designer of high end shoes is the favourite of Sex and the City character Carrie Bradshaw played by Sarah Jessica Parker ?



    30. The title of which Oasis Album is a quote from words written by Isaac Newton ?


    31. What is the name of the island off the coast of Anglesey that Holyhead is located on ?



    32. What is the nickname usually given to Bruce Springsteen ?



    33. Which property on a standard UK Monopoly Board is the location of the Royal Opera House, Covent Garden ?



    34. The River Spree flows through which European Capital City ?



    35. Rugby Union - who was the full-time coach of Wales immediately prior to Warren Gatland’s appointment in 2007 ?



    36. Between 1997 and 2002 Beyonce Knowles was a member of which American girl group ?



    37. Who was the last UK Prime Minister not to have gone to Oxford University ?


    38. What is the first name of French composer Ravel ?



    39. In 1821 Peru gained independence from which country?


    40. HNO3 is the chemical formula of which acid ?
